well, yeah...you are going to get the best imaging from a set of components in kick panels and a nice set of midbass. Also, that sub is obviously gonna wang...i'd keep it in a sealed box. As for rear fill, i'd ditch the 3 ways for the rear and just keep the coax's for rear fill. Don't want to pull your imaging to the back like he said. Also, with the kind of sound you're wanting...i'd look into a nice equalizer...possibly 31 band PG (i think pg...not sure i'll look up the specific one soon) but good luck...it'll take a lot of time to coreectly plan this out and create good imaging.
